Output 8837658259a3a11573ce789a61724a9b4751ea172a2678c624c89c3b6a19cba9:0

value
11750989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b0b1ed54733de359417aafce8f5a04545545e6 OP_EQUAL
address
3QpQZ4aqS9aFuBmDL7q5x6XL9CJ1BRLwBC
transaction
8837658259a3a11573ce789a61724a9b4751ea172a2678c624c89c3b6a19cba9
spent
true